    Hi there... Optometrist here.
    First, this won't have any impact on your IVF. Secondly, it's probably inflammatory and you most likely will need a steroid eye drop to clear it up. If you have any sort of discharge, it might be bacterial also. If it doesn't get at least 50 better by tomorrow, you should try to have it looked at.
    It's a really annoying and painful thing to happen to the eye and I'm sorry that you have to deal with that on top of everything else. Let me know if you have questions. Feel better....
